A Scenic Journey Like No Other

The adventure begins early in the morning at Kathmandu’s Tribhuvan International Airport. You board a modern helicopter, designed for high-altitude flights, ensuring safety and comfort. As the helicopter takes off, you’ll fly over lush valleys, terraced fields, and charming Sherpa villages. The views of the Himalayan range, including peaks like Lhotse, Nuptse, and Ama Dablam, are breathtaking. Within an hour, you’ll reach Lukla, a small mountain town, for a quick refueling stop.

From Lukla, the helicopter heads toward Everest Base Camp, soaring over the iconic Khumbu Glacier and rugged landscapes. You’ll get a bird’s-eye view of the base camp at 5,364 meters, where climbers prepare to summit Everest. The tour also includes a flyover of Kala Patthar, the best viewpoint for stunning panoramic views of Mount Everest. These moments make the Everest Base Camp Helicopter Tour Price worth every penny.

Landing at Hotel Everest View

A highlight of the tour is landing at the Hotel Everest View in Syangboche, one of the highest hotels in the world. Here, you’ll enjoy a delicious breakfast with Mount Everest as your backdrop. The hotel offers a cozy setting to relax and soak in the Himalayan beauty. You’ll have about an hour to take photos, sip tea, and marvel at peaks like Pumori and Cho Oyu. This luxurious stop adds a unique touch to the journey.

Why Choose a Helicopter Tour?

Unlike the traditional 12–14-day trek to Everest Base Camp, this helicopter tour takes just 4–5 hours. It’s ideal for travelers with limited time, families, or those unable to trek due to physical constraints. The tour is accessible to all ages, making it a family-friendly adventure. Plus, the helicopter’s large windows ensure everyone gets a clear view of the stunning scenery.

Safety is a priority, with experienced pilots and well-maintained helicopters. The tour operates year-round, but spring (March–May) and autumn (September–November) offer the clearest skies and best visibility. However, weather can be unpredictable, so flexibility is key. Cost for Everest Base Camp Helicopter Tour

The Cost for Everest Base Camp Helicopter Tour varies based on group size and whether you choose a private or shared flight. For 2025 and 2026, prices typically range from USD 1,250 to USD 6,500 per person. A shared tour for up to five passengers costs around USD 1,300 per person, while private charters are pricier. Additional fees, like national park permits (NPR 7,000), may apply. Booking early, especially for peak seasons, ensures the best Everest Base Camp Helicopter Tour Price.
